E99 MAP Sensor

Hello everyone, hope your Thanksgiving Day weekend has been great.

I'm trying to determine why my MAP sensor is constantly showing 14.6 - 14.7 psi on AE, yet I'm not getting any error codes or sensor faults. I have verified that that the little hose connecting the sensor to the spider is clear and not leaking, and even verified that the there is certainly pressure within that hose.

The electrical connection looks good, and when disconnected I do get the error code on AE. The truck doesn't run great, but it's certainly getting some amount of boost. Just like to know if there's anything else I could be overlooking before I drop $100 on a new sensor.

Also, any recommendations on MAP sensors, are they finicky like the CPS sensors?

You could apply various amounts of regulated air to the MAP sensor and look for changes in the readings on your AE. I'm not sure what years were affected, but I read some years ago about the sealant inside the sensor softening and blocking the port.
